Home demolition services involve the careful dismantling and removal of entire residential structures. These services typically include the controlled tearing down of a house or other residential buildings, ensuring that the process complies with safety standards and local regulations. Demolition contractors utilize specialized equipment and techniques to efficiently and safely bring down structures, often preparing the site for new development or renovations. The scope of work can range from partial demolitions, such as removing a specific section of a property, to complete teardown of an entire building.
This service addresses several common property concerns, including unsafe or structurally compromised buildings, properties that are no longer suitable for habitation, or sites designated for new construction projects. Demolition helps eliminate hazards like unstable walls, rotting wood, or outdated infrastructure that could pose safety risks. It also clears the way for property upgrades, enabling new construction or landscaping projects to proceed without obstructions. Proper demolition ensures that debris is removed efficiently, minimizing disruption to the surrounding area.

Cost Range - Home demolition services typically cost between $4,000 and $15,000, depending on the size and complexity of the structure. For example, a small shed removal may be around $2,500, while a full house demolition can reach $20,000 or more.
Factors Affecting Cost - The overall cost varies based on factors such as building size, location, and accessibility. Additional costs may include permits, debris removal, and utility disconnection, which can add $1,000 to $5,000 to the total.
Typical Pricing Models - Many service providers charge a flat fee for complete demolition projects, ranging from $5,000 to $12,000. Some may offer estimates based on cubic yards of material or square footage of the structure.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s can include asbestos or hazardous material removal, which might add $1,500 to $10,000. It is common for contractors to provide detailed quotes after assessing the specific project requ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
